About the Project

Increased efficiency of N use in dairy production is proposed as a key action to reduce environmental N contamination, and mathematical models provide a powerful tool to help with this. We are planning to use two models: the Cornell Net Carbohydrate and Protein System (CNCPS; a cow-based model), developed at Cornell University in the US, and the Cattle Nitrogen use Efficiency (CNE; a herd-based model), developed at Aberystwyth University. These models will be further updated to include amino acid metabolism (CNCPS), and heifer growth, cattle fertility and economics (CNE), to increase their accuracy and their commercial potential. Model updates will form part of a larger project (H2020-MSCA project: CowficieNcy) involving several partners from different countries, among them Cornell University.

For the work related to this PhD studentship, it is expected that the student will be involved in the update of the CNE model, particularly related to heifer growth. Dairy heifer rearing constitutes the second highest cost for dairy farmers, and represents a significant loss of nutrients to the environment. Similarly, in terms of N use efficiency the replacement of a cow within a herd represents the second largest loss of N following losses during milk production. Therefore, an improved heifer model would be expected enable better heifer growth strategies and overall improvement of herd N use efficiency.

In parallel, we will survey farms in Wales to gather data about whole-farm N balance. This studentship will help Aberystwyth University strengthen its links with Wynnstay, a major feed supplier in Wales, in the development of Welsh knowledge exchange activities with the dairy farming sector. For this part of the project, we will gather data that will be useful for Wynnstay and provide high level support on farm nutrient management, enabling model simulations to be performed. Based on our analysis, we will deliver a report to each farm with proposed actions for improvement. Depending on proposed interventions, we will visit and sample farms every 6 months, and provide advice in the form of individual improvement programmes based on upgraded models.
